#2d0724 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d0724 is composed of 17.6% red, 2.7%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.4% magenta, 20% yellow and 82.4% black. It has a hue angle of 314.2 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 10.2%. #2d0724 color hex could be obtained by blending #5a0e48 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#2d0724 color description : Very dark (mostly black) magenta.
#2d0724 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d0724 has RGB values of R:45, G:7,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.2,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 2950948.

Shades and Tints of #2d0724
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0209 is the darkest color, while #fef9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d0724
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1b191b is the less saturated color, while #330127 is the most saturated one.
